    Osun Cleric Fatally Stabbed While Mediating Couple’s Dispute

    • Husband Arrested After Tragic Incident at Estranged Wife’s Home
    • Community in Mourning as Clergyman’s Life Ends in Shocking Circumstances

    In a heart-wrenching turn of events, Bishop Shina Olaribigbe of Rapture Empowerment International, Osogbo, was tragically stabbed to death early Thursday while attempting to mediate a dispute between an estranged couple.

    The incident occurred at the BCGA area of Osogbo, where the late clergyman often helped resolve disputes. According to sources, the wife involved in the altercation was a member of Olaribigbe’s congregation and served as an interpreter in the church.

    A History of Discord

    Reports indicate that the couple, who have a history of frequent disputes, lived apart despite not being legally separated. While the specifics of their latest argument remain unclear, the husband reportedly visited his estranged wife’s residence and found Olaribigbe there, an encounter that escalated into violence.

    A source close to the church disclosed, “The pastor was at the wife’s residence to check on her health, as she had been unwell. The husband arrived unexpectedly, became enraged, and stabbed the bishop in the chest. He died instantly.”

    Both the husband and wife were arrested and are currently being held at the Dugbe Police Division in Osogbo. Olaribigbe’s body has been deposited at the UNIOSUN Teaching Hospital morgue.

    Police Investigation

    The Osun State Police Command confirmed the incident. Public Relations Officer Yemisi Opalola stated, “The pastor often mediated disputes between the couple. On this occasion, the husband arrived to find the pastor in the wife’s room and, acting on suspicion of an affair, stabbed him multiple times. The pastor succumbed to his injuries on the spot.”

    Community in Mourning

    The death of Bishop Olaribigbe has left his congregation and the Osogbo community in shock. Many have taken to social media to express their grief and disbelief.

    A Facebook user, Oyeleye Isaac, mourned, “BREAKING AND VERY SAD NEWS, WE LOST ONE OF OUR HEROES, Bishop Dr. Olaribigbe Greatness. Why! Why! Why?” Another, Mr. Bimbo, lamented, “You called to wish me Happy Birthday yesterday.”

    As investigations continue, the tragic incident has raised questions about the risks faced by individuals who attempt to mediate in domestic disputes, a sobering reminder of the volatility such situations can entail.
